Self Defense
It's another long night,
Wrapped in my blanket
Crippled in the corner,
Darkness taking my sight.
Strength decayed,
But still I fight.
I try to escape all that I fear--
Hiding so many secrets,
Putting up walls,
But still they come near...
Breaching my defenses
Letting me know that they're always here.
If only you were here to protect me;
Maybe spare me some strength...
Give me some hope.
But that is not a light I'll ever see.
You've left me stranded,
On my own for eternity.
Soon I will have to fall in defeat.
Let them overtake me--
No surrender,
No retreat.
It is my destiny;
But why so bitter sweet?
